At Specialist Passenger Solutions (SPS) we are dedicated to providing the perfect journey.

SPS was formed in 2016 and serves the passenger transport needs of the EDF Nuclear Project at Hinkley Point C (HPC) in Bridgwater, the largest construction project in Europe. We are the only transport provider for the thousands of people who go to the construction site daily to work or visit. We are now bringing this experience to Sizewell C in Suffolk, providing safe, reliable, and efficient transport for its workforce.

We are first and foremost a people business with our colleagues and clients at our heart. We bring together an exceptional mix of people to provide specialist passenger transport solutions, delivering excellence in all that we do.

We continue to invest in our people, our services and state‑of‑the‑art technology as we look to improve our customers’ experiences. Our drivers undergo rigorous training focused on safety, responsibility, and customer service, ensuring those on board have an enjoyable journey.

SPS is a division of First Bus.

Specialist Passenger Solutions provides essential bus services transporting thousands of workers to and from Sizewell

C. By joining our technician team, you will work across a variety of vehicle types, including electric, hydrogen and diesel vehicles, using cutting‑edge diagnostic technology.

You will play a key role in ensuring vehicles meet our safety and performance standards, enabling us to deliver outstanding service for our customers every day.

Summary of key duties & responsibilities:
  • To be part of a team providing MOT preparation, vehicle inspection, maintenance, diagnostic and repair services to a varied PCV fleet
  • To maintain a clear understanding of vehicle inspection standards and compliance requirements
  • To be part of the process of promoting and ensuring a good working relationship between the engineering and operations departments, essential to achieving our shared objectives
  • To follow all procedures to control and monitor parts usage and stock control
  • As part of the engineering team, to be consistently proactive in ensuring that peak vehicle requirement is achieved
Essential for the role:
  • Minimum NVQ Level 3 or C&G equivalent or above in Heavy Vehicle Maintenance (PCV preferred)
  • At least two years relevant, recent, and demonstrable post training experience in heavy vehicle engineering, preferably PCV
  • The ability to apply consistently high standards of technical judgement
  • A pragmatic and proactive, can‑do attitude to short notice workshop deadlines
  • A flexible approach to working hours as we work towards becoming a 24/7 business
  • Possession of a full driving licence (category D desirable)
Desirable for the role:
  • PCV Electrical system aptitude and experience in the bus industry
  • Good electrical and diagnostic ability
  • Possession of IRTEC licence (Inspection / Service Maintenance Technician)
  • Knowledge of the transport sector
